A talented British baker and cake artist has created a life-sized sponge cake dedicated to the Duke and Duchess of Sussex. Lara Mason from Brownhills spent over 250 hours creating a beautiful cake in the likeness of Prince Harry and Meghan. In a nod to the soon-to-be-parents, her beautiful cake shows Daddy-to-be prince harry carrying a green- bag which contains baby products like lotion, milk bottle, some napkins and a teddy bear. On his side is mommy-to-be Meghan Markle holding a 'Baby book'.

"With added baby bump and all the necessities that come with having a little one," wrote Ms Mason on Facebook, sharing a picture of her massive cake.

According to reports, the 6.5-foot tall Harry and Meghan cake was baked using 300 eggs and 50 kg of fondant icing. Everything used in the cake, except its frame, is edible.

The cake could feed upto 1,000 people and was on display at Cake International, a baking festival where it received a lot of praise and appreciation from spectators.

Prince Harry and Meghan Markle recently announced that they are expecting their first child. Announcing the news, Kensington Palace tweeted  "Their Royal Highnesses The Duke and Duchess of Sussex are very pleased to announce that The Duchess of Sussex is expecting a baby in the Spring of 2019,"

The royal couple is currently globetrotting and during their stop in New Zealand on Monday, Prince Harry referred to his and Meghan Markle's soon-to-be-born child as 'our little bump' Further, he also thanked everyone for their hospitality during their stay and revealed that he and Meghan Markle are extremely grateful to be there. 

The international tour is said to be the first one for the Duke and Duchess since they got married, apart from a two-day visit to Ireland. Prince Harry, the sixth in line to the British throne took up vows with former Hollywood actress and longtime girlfriend Meghan. The celebration was attended by several international celebrities including Indian actress Priyanka Chopra.
